8 feb 1887 año - Dawes Act
Descripción:
The Dawes Severity Act of 1887 was used to dissolve many tribal organizations and attempted to assimilate or “americanize” natives. This included assigning 160 acres of land to a native family which interrupted their nomadic way of life. Dawes Act was significant in that it further oppressed natives and therefore opened the way for more Americans to move West.
